Early Childhood Education Grant Funders in Maine

18 foundations with a documented early childhood education focus have made grants to Maine nonprofits in recent years, together directing $11.0M to organizations across the state. How this list is built. Bespoke Grants indexes 13M+ grants from public IRS Form 990 filings. This page shows foundations whose giving carries a documented early childhood education focus and that have funded Maine nonprofits. Giving figures reflect each funder's total recent grants to Maine recipients. IRS data publishes on a 1–2 year lag; figures are current through the most recent available filings.
